What is Fiesta?
Fiesta is a unique tabletop game designed to bring friends and family together through tactical gameplay and spontaneous fun. The game is centered around a fictional festival where participants compete to collect resources, make alliances, and outmaneuver their opponents in a lively atmosphere.
The Mechanics of Rollino
The true essence of Fiesta lies in its innovative Rollino system. This mechanic dictates the pace and scope of the game by introducing a multi-faceted dice mechanism that embodies both unpredictability and strategic depth. At the start of each round, players roll a set of specially crafted Rollino dice, each emblazoned with symbols representing different festival elements such as music notes, firework icons, and food items.
How to Play Fiesta with Rollino
To begin a game of Fiesta, players must first set up the festival board, distributing resource cards and setting up event miniatures across the game area. Each player receives a personalized player board where they accumulate points and track their progress throughout the festival season.
Setting Up
- Distribute resource and event cards equally among participants.
- Place Rollino dice in the center, each symbolizing various festival aspects.
- Allocate player tokens and create a turn sequence order.
Rolling the Dice
At the beginning of each player's turn, they roll the Rollino dice to determine the potential actions available based on the symbols shown. The Rollino element requires strategic foresight, as players must decide whether to use dice for accumulating resources or for triggering special festival events that can greatly alter the game’s course.
